This prediction market topic focuses on additional betting markets for the Colombian Primera A soccer match between CDP Junior FC and CA Bucaramanga, scheduled for March 23 at 9:30 PM Eastern Time. The primary match result market is often supplemented by these 'more markets,' which allow participants to wager on specific in-game events and statistical outcomes beyond the final score. These markets typically include propositions like total goals scored, whether both teams will score, exact score predictions, halftime results, and individual player performance metrics such as first goal scorer or number of shots on target. The availability and pricing of these markets reflect bookmakers' assessments of team form, tactical matchups, and historical data between the clubs. The rivalry between CDP Junior FC and CA Bucaramanga dates to their first official meeting in 1990, a 1-1 draw in the Copa Mustang. Junior, based in Barranquilla, is one of Colombia's most successful clubs with 9 national championships, most recently in 2019. Bucaramanga, from the Santander department, has never won the Primera A title, with their best finish being runners-up in 1997. This historical disparity creates a classic dynamic of established power versus ambitious challenger. In head-to-head statistics, Junior holds a clear advantage with 28 wins compared to Bucaramanga's 12, alongside 18 draws across all competitions. Their most memorable encounter occurred in the 2015 Copa Colombia semifinals, where Junior won 4-2 on aggregate. The teams have met twice annually in league play since 2015, with the home team winning 60% of those matches. The historical goal difference favors Junior by +19 goals over 58 total meetings. Recent history shows a shift, however, as Bucaramanga earned a 2-0 victory in their most recent match in October 2023, breaking a five-game winless streak against Junior. This result contributed to Bucaramanga's surprising 2023 Apertura campaign where they finished third, their best league position in over two decades.
The proliferation of 'more markets' for matches like Junior vs. Bucaramanga reflects the broader economic transformation of sports betting into a global industry projected to exceed $100 billion annually. In Colombia specifically, regulated sports betting through platforms like Wplay and Rushbet generates significant tax revenue, estimated at over $50 million USD for the government in 2023. These markets create employment for data analysts, odds compilers, and compliance officers within the growing Colombian gaming sector. For the league itself, increased betting interest correlates with higher television ratings and digital engagement, as demonstrated by a 15% viewership increase for matches with active proposition markets. This attention translates to improved sponsorship valuations for clubs and broadcasters. Beyond economics, these markets affect how fans experience the sport, encouraging deeper statistical analysis and engagement with tactical elements beyond simple fandom. They also raise important regulatory questions about match integrity, leading to increased collaboration between the Colombian Football Federation and monitoring organizations like Sportradar to detect unusual betting patterns.

The most traded proposition markets for Primera A matches include 'both teams to score,' 'total corners over/under,' 'first half result,' and 'correct score' predictions. Player-specific markets like 'anytime goal scorer' for star forwards also see significant volume.
